Wedding at Oheka Castle in Cold Spring Harbor, New York

Cassandra and Daniel’s story is really cool. They met on Match.com, had their first date at Washington Rock State Park and later Daniel brought Cassandra back to this memorable spot to make his proposal.

The bride and groom got married on October 1, 2011 at the famous Oheka Castle in Cold Spring Harbor, New York. The morning started off with a some drama as Daniel’s tuxedo took its time getting up to his room but after that little bump in the road the day was off and running. The creative session with Chris from Brett Matthew’s Photography was a blast. Cassandra and Daniel were troopers even when we asked them to do some fast dancing right on the lawn!

The day was just getting started though as the supremely talented singing group The Unexpected Boys brought down the house during the ceremony. Then it was on to the reception where in addition to some off the hook dancing we learned that bride’s dad has a list of 10 rules for dating his daughter that he had to be dissuaded from showing Daniel when Cassandra brought him home. Wedding at Jericho Terrace in New York


Wedding Highlight at Jericho Terrace in New York
Wow this wedding day was filled with a lot of stuff. Starting with the bride, we chatted about how Heather was obsessed with the classic movie “Adventures in Babysitting” and also how she got so excited about wedding planning that she started her own event planning company with one of her bridesmaids. Meanwhile, Joseph explained to us about his passion for football and hockey and we even got to see them play a little before they got ready at the Marriott Hotel in Islandia. Joseph and his groomsmen are also avid Fantasy Football fans as he explains too.

As we arrived at the church, Cindy from Cynthia Ross Affairs was diligently setting up the decor inside. Fast forward and hour later and here comes the bride, along with the cute flower girl and ring bearer holding that very same sign to alert the masses that Heather was about to walk down the aisle.

The ceremony went just as planned but some things did not. Originally we were going to make it to the Children’s Museum in Garden City to shoot some creative shots but as we all know, November is the month that we notice the sun just disappears early. So, we decided to hang at the church a little longer and take advantage of “magic hour” which is when the sun becomes a beautiful amber right before setting.

The reception was awesome and MRG Entertainment made sure of this. It took place at Jericho Terrace in Mineola, New York. This wedding video highlight is the very first one that we used 35mm film stock emulation from CineGrain. CineGrain is a film stock company that offers world class film looks for hollywood and commercial films. Sit back and enjoy this short highlight of Heather and Joseph’s wedding.
